The logical problem is that we're very limited to the amount of controls we can use for our spacecraft. It's possible but would be tricky to get it working with the least amount of buttons as possible. It would take two keys just to manually open and close the s-foil wings. One key to open them, and one to close them. I haven't looked into the controls enough to see if there's a "toggle" type button. If there is, I could make the gear open and close by the press of the "g" key.

Simply put, I'll test around and see what happens. It depends on alot of factors. I will keep you guys updated.
